Metalloid
Metalloids are a group of chemical elements with properties that are intermediate between those of metals and nonmetals.
term used in chemistry when classifying the chemical elements. On the basis of their general physical and chemical properties, nearly every element in the periodic table can be termed either a metal or a nonmetal. A few elements with intermediate properties are, however, referred to as metalloids. (In Greek metallon = metal and eidos = sort)
There is no rigorous definition of the term, but the following properties are usually considered characteristic of metalloids:
- metalloids often form amphoteric oxides.
- metalloids often behave as semiconductors (B,Si,Ge) to semimetals (eg. Sb).

Some allotropes of elements exhibit more pronounced metal, metalloid or non-metal behavior than others. For example, for the element carbon, its diamond allotrope is clearly non-metallic, but the graphite allotrope displays limited electric conductivity more characteristic of a metalloid. Phosphorus, tin, selenium and bismuth also have allotropes that display borderline behavior.
Position in the Periodic Table
In the standard layout of the periodic table, metalloids occur along a diagonal line through the p block, from boron to polonium. Elements to the upper right of this line display increasing nonmetallic behavior; elements to the lower left display increasing metallic behavior. This line is called the "stair-step" or "staircase." The poor metals are to the left and down, and the nonmetals are to the right and up.

Metalloid or semiconductor?
Some metalloids, such as silicon and germanium, are semiconductors, implying that they can carry an electric charge under certain conditions. However, the concepts of metalloid and semiconductor should not be confused with each other. The term metalloid refers to the properties of certain elements in relation to the periodic table. The term semiconductor refers to the physical properties of materials (including alloys and compounds). There is only partial overlap between the two.
